Usage Examples
Bicep Samples
A basic example of deploying ExpressRoute gateway.
param resourceName string = 'acctest0001'
param location string = 'westeurope'
resource virtualWan 'Microsoft.Network/virtualWans@2022-07-01' = {
name: resourceName
location: location
properties: {
allowBranchToBranchTraffic: true
disableVpnEncryption: false
office365LocalBreakoutCategory: 'None'
type: 'Standard'
}
}
resource expressRouteGateway 'Microsoft.Network/expressRouteGateways@2022-07-01' = {
name: resourceName
location: location
properties: {
allowNonVirtualWanTraffic: false
autoScaleConfiguration: {
bounds: {
min: 1
}
}
virtualHub: {
id: virtualHub.id
}
}
}
resource virtualHub 'Microsoft.Network/virtualHubs@2022-07-01' = {
name: resourceName
location: location
properties: {
addressPrefix: '10.0.1.0/24'
hubRoutingPreference: 'ExpressRoute'
virtualRouterAutoScaleConfiguration: {
minCapacity: 2
}
virtualWan: {
id: virtualWan.id
}
}
}

To create a Microsoft.Network/expressRouteGateways resource, add the following Bicep to your template.
resource symbolicname 'Microsoft.Network/expressRouteGateways@2019-04-01' = {
location: 'string'
name: 'string'
properties: {
autoScaleConfiguration: {
bounds: {
max: int
min: int
}
}
virtualHub: {
id: 'string'
}
}
tags: {
{customized property}: 'string'
}
}
Property Values
Microsoft.Network/expressRouteGateways
| Name |
Description |
Value |
| location |
Resource location. |
string |
| name |
The resource name |
string (required) |
| properties |
Properties of the express route gateway. |
ExpressRouteGatewayProperties |
| tags |
Resource tags |
Dictionary of tag names and values. See Tags in templates |
ExpressRouteGatewayProperties
ExpressRouteGatewayPropertiesAutoScaleConfiguration
ExpressRouteGatewayPropertiesAutoScaleConfigurationBounds
| Name |
Description |
Value |
| max |
Maximum number of scale units deployed for ExpressRoute gateway. |
int |
| min |
Minimum number of scale units deployed for ExpressRoute gateway. |
int |
VirtualHubId
| Name |
Description |
Value |
| id |
The resource URI for the Virtual Hub where the ExpressRoute gateway is or will be deployed. The Virtual Hub resource and the ExpressRoute gateway resource reside in the same subscription. |
string |

Usage Examples
A basic example of deploying ExpressRoute gateway.
terraform {
required_providers {
azapi = {
source = "Azure/azapi"
}
}
}
provider "azapi" {
skip_provider_registration = false
}
variable "resource_name" {
type = string
default = "acctest0001"
}
variable "location" {
type = string
default = "westeurope"
}
resource "azapi_resource" "resourceGroup" {
type = "Microsoft.Resources/resourceGroups@2020-06-01"
name = var.resource_name
location = var.location
}
resource "azapi_resource" "virtualWan" {
type = "Microsoft.Network/virtualWans@2022-07-01"
parent_id = azapi_resource.resourceGroup.id
name = var.resource_name
location = var.location
body = {
properties = {
allowBranchToBranchTraffic = true
disableVpnEncryption = false
office365LocalBreakoutCategory = "None"
type = "Standard"
}
}
schema_validation_enabled = false
response_export_values = ["*"]
}
resource "azapi_resource" "virtualHub" {
type = "Microsoft.Network/virtualHubs@2022-07-01"
parent_id = azapi_resource.resourceGroup.id
name = var.resource_name
location = var.location
body = {
properties = {
addressPrefix = "10.0.1.0/24"
hubRoutingPreference = "ExpressRoute"
virtualRouterAutoScaleConfiguration = {
minCapacity = 2
}
virtualWan = {
id = azapi_resource.virtualWan.id
}
}
}
schema_validation_enabled = false
response_export_values = ["*"]
}
resource "azapi_resource" "expressRouteGateway" {
type = "Microsoft.Network/expressRouteGateways@2022-07-01"
parent_id = azapi_resource.resourceGroup.id
name = var.resource_name
location = var.location
body = {
properties = {
allowNonVirtualWanTraffic = false
autoScaleConfiguration = {
bounds = {
min = 1
}
}
virtualHub = {
id = azapi_resource.virtualHub.id
}
}
}
schema_validation_enabled = false
response_export_values = ["*"]
}
